Rat Terrier Breed Profile

Breed Name: Rat Terrier

Description:
Compact muscular dogs with strong legs and shoulders but with tiny heads, Rat Terriers are born with long or short tails which may be docked shortly after birth

Height:
12 - 15 inches

Weight:
12 - 18 lbs

Colors:
Rat Terriers come in various color combinations including red and white, tri-spotted, solid red, black & tan, blue & white and red brindle

Coat:
short smooth

Temperament:
Rat Terriers are spunky and lively and require lots of exercise. They can also be quite vocal during playtime. Good with both children and the elderly, Rat Terriers make excellent watchdogs

Care and Exercise:
Rat Terriers are low maintenance, need little grooming, easily trained with positive reinforcement

Health Issues:
none

Category:
Terrier

Registries:
UKC, UKCI, NRTR, CKC

Living Environment:
Rat Terriers will do okay living in an apartment. However they are active dogs and require plenty of exercise. They love to dig and will dig themselves out of a fenced yard
